The next morning, Liz woke to a gentle massage on her shoulders. “Mmmmm.”

“Good morning,” Jem whispered into her ear. He kneaded a knot of tension in her shoulder.

“Oh!” She arched her back; the pain was so intense after last night. Damien had hurt her more than usual.

“I’m sorry.” Jem kissed the spot, and then continued a trail of kisses up her throat to her mouth.

Liz threw herself into the kiss, everything she felt for Jem was on display. The passion kept rising until he drew back.

“Where did this come from?” He stroked her chin, and smiled into her eyes.

She just smiled back and brushed his hair back from his face. She loved looking at Jem, his strong features with the blond hair and blue eyes had a most devastating effect on most women, including her. She was lucky to have him, and she had almost lost him. She had never though her flaming red hair and green eyes would make her pretty. She had been called a temptress by others, but she was far from it.

She had grown up near the ocean, the castle that her family owned stood at the top of the cliff, looking down onto the rocks and the waves. Liz had loved the sea, and it broke her heart to be away from it, but Jem was more important to her.

He was so important, that he never needed to find out about what she had done with Damien the night before. Or the previous times she had been in his company. Although, she wasn’t willing, she was still a part of it, and she had no way of stopping it on her own.

She now looked into Jem’s eyes and just shook her head.

There was a knock on the door, causing both of them to look. Jem pulled on his robe and walked over to the door. “Yes?”

“Your Grace, you are needed in the parlor. Lord Blackburn has asked for your presence,” the butler replied. He promptly turned and strode down the hall.

Jem turned back to her, “I’m sorry, love.”

He bent down to kiss her, “We’ll finish this later.”

Liz hummed her agreement into his mouth, and then watched as he put on his shirt and waistcoat, followed by his jacket and his boots. He gave her one last smile then closed the door behind him as he went to meet with Damien.

Liz sat and wondered what was so important that Damien had to meet with Jem right now. She gave up, knowing that she would chase herself in circles, and started to get dressed. She rang the bell for the maid and when no one answered, she rang it once again. When there was still no response she called out. Coming to the realization that she was on her own she tried to start putting on her many layers.

She was struggling with her corset when she felt hands over hers, taking the cords and pulling them tight. “Oh, Penny, I thought you had gone out.”

There was no response, and Liz turned to look at her. But her gaze never met Penny’s; Liz’s eyes met the gaze of Damien. She turned forcefully, causing him to let go of her cords. “What are you doing here? I held up my end of the bargain last night. What more do you want?”

Damien smiled,” My dear, I will never have enough of you. It has always been that way, and it always will.”

“You still have not answered my question, Damien,” Liz narrowed her eyes to slits. She didn’t trust him at all.

He held up his hands in a sort of truce, “Do not worry. I will only take what I want at night, but right now I came to renegotiate our deal.”

“There will be no more negotiating here. We settled the matter.” Liz turned from him and walked to the window, she could see her past in the reflection. Three children frolicking in the grass next to the cliffs, they had been best friends, where had they gone?
